How they compare
Germany currently reports 13 against 12 in Armenia, a difference of 1.
That makes Germany's figure about 1.1 times Armenia's.
Across all 27 years both countries report, Germany has been ahead every year.
Armenia ranks 3rd and Germany ranks 1st of 73 countries.
Germany has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Armenia | Germany |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 10 | 13 | 3 | Germany |
| 2000s | 10 | 13 | 3 | Germany |
| 2010s | 11.7 | 13 | 1.3 | Germany |
| 2020s | 12 | 13 | 1 | Germany |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
